Kök Hücre Tedavisi: A Revolutionary Approach to Pulmonary Hypertension
Stem cell therapy involves the transplantation of stem cells, which have the remarkable ability to differentiate into various cell types. In the context of PH, stem cells are being used to repair damaged lung tissue and restore the normal function of the pulmonary vasculature. Preclinical studies have demonstrated the potential of stem cell therapy to reduce pulmonary artery pressure, akciğer fonksiyonunu iyileştirmek, and increase survival rates in animal models of PH.
Clinical Applications and Patient Outcomes in Japan
Several clinical trials in Japan have investigated the safety and efficacy of stem cell therapy for PH. One notable study, conducted at the National Cerebral and Cardiovascular Center in Osaka, involved the transplantation of autologous bone marrow-derived stem cells into patients with severe PH. The results showed significant improvements in pulmonary artery pressure, egzersiz kapasitesi, ve yaşam kalitesi. Another study, conducted at the Kyoto University Hospital, demonstrated the feasibility and safety of allogeneic umbilical cord blood-derived stem cell transplantation in patients with PH. These promising findings have paved the way for further clinical trials and the potential development of stem cell therapy as a standard treatment option for PH.
